RT Journal Article T1 Rediscovering copper-based catalysts for intramolecular carbon–hydrogen bond functionalization by carbene insertion A1 Martín Gandul, Carmen A1 Rodríguez Belderraín, Tomás A1 Pérez Romero, Pedro José AB A series of Tp(x)Cu complexes (Tp(x) = hydrotrispyrazolylborate ligand) have been tested as catalysts for the decomposition of several diazoacetates and N,N-disubstituted diazoacetamides and the subsequent formation of lactones and lactams, respectively. The complexes containing the ligands Tp(Br3) or Tp(Ms) have provided activities and selectivities for these transformations comparable with or, in some cases, better than the well-known rhodium catalyst Rh(2)(OAc)(4) PB Royal Society of Chemistry SN 1477-0520 SN 1477-0539 (electrónico) YR 2009 FD 2009 LK https://hdl.handle.net/10272/22794 UL https://hdl.handle.net/10272/22794 LA eng NO Martín, C., Belderraín, T.
